Pit Boss
Incomplete Combustion / Poor Air-Fuel Mix
Excessive white smoke and sooty buildup on food and inside grill.

Possible Causes
Wet or low-quality pellets, Restricted combustion air from dirty fan or intake, Overfilled firepot, Low combustion temperature due to high P-setting
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Ensure adequate ventilation around the grill; do not operate in enclosed spaces.
- Step 1 – Replace pellets: Discard any damp or crumbly pellets and refill with dry, high-quality pellets.
- Step 2 – Clean firepot and fan: Vacuum ash from firepot and clean fan blades and intake vents.
- Step 3 – Adjust P-setting and temperature: Run at a slightly higher temperature or lower P-setting to promote cleaner combustion.
- Step 4 – Inspect exhaust: Ensure chimney cap is not set too low and that exhaust path is clear.
